Wrongful Termination in Culver City: What You Need to Know

Experiencing termination in Culver City can be difficult, and it's crucial to understand your protections under California law. Regrettably, many workers believe they were unfairly discharged. Wrongful dismissal occurs when an business violates employment regulations . This can include retaliation for reporting illegal conduct, discrimination based on attributes such as religion or disability, or breach of contract. Generally, California is an "at-will" region, meaning an company can terminate an employee for almost any reason as long as it's not illegal. However, several loopholes exist. If you suspect your termination was wrongful, consider these points:

  • Retaliation: Were you terminated after complaining of illegal or unethical behavior ?
  • Discrimination: Was your firing related to your heritage, years of experience , sex , or another characteristic protected by law?
  • Breach of Contract: Did you have a formal employment contract that was broken ?

Constructive Separation Claims in the City – Do You Eligible?

Navigating job disputes in this City can be challenging, and constructive separation claims add another layer of confusion. A implied termination occurs when your company creates a unbearable work atmosphere forcing you to leave your role. To be approved for benefits related to a de facto separation, you’ll generally need to show that your company's actions were significant enough to make continued employment impossible, and that you carefully tried to address the situation before quitting.
